He’s married to Melinda (de Armas), a terminally amorous woman who seemingly hates Vic. Vic (Affleck) is a man who invented a microchip that’s integral to drone warfare he’s become rich off of drone murders. The film drops its audience right in the middle of an odd domestic arrangement. Sparring around their precocious child, they insult each other with lascivious sighs and purrs that sound like threats.Īlso there’s some light murder. The two real-life exes play a married couple who are equally hot and hateful, and spend a lot of time torturing each other and their New Orleans neighbors.
